Subject: Plinthkit versioning policy — please review before approving

Hi,

Before you approve the Plinthkit 4.0 release PR, note that we are moving the shared component library to strict semantic versioning. Any prop removal or renamed slot is now a major bump, enforced by the Coppergate CI check. Please confirm the changelog entries match the API diff, and flag anything ambiguous rather than waving it through. The release candidate you should review against is identified by the token below.

trace token, fafog-kageg: htk4_98e6

## Break-Glass: Snapstack Snapshot Suite

Support: if snapshot tests for Fernwheel UI components block a hotfix, use break-glass access to approve the diff override. Log the ticket number first. Access expires after one hour. The break-glass console prompts for the recovery passphrase, which is provided below.

vault phrase of tawig-taduf = zorath-oliwyn

Handover — Raffle Drums

Two raffle drums for the Bellcroft staff party are on pallet 9, wrapped and labelled. Hinges are loose on the larger one, so keep it flat, don't roll it. Tickets are already loaded and the lids are zip-tied shut — leave them that way. Courier from Pinrow Freight collects at 13:00 from bay 2. Release them only per the confidential hand-over line below.

handover note for yagef-bagep: the drudor pelius courier leaves the kasdor zorvan norir ledger at gate 8016 under passcode 755406